背景情况:
- 三维 (3D) 基因组架构对于基因表达调节至关重要.
- 在体壮瘤中3D基因组结构的改变尚未得到充分理解.
研究的目的:
- 为了研究体瘤的3D基因组结构.
- 为了将3D基因组变化与这些瘤中的基因表达模式相关联.
主要方法:
- 使用Hi-C和RNA-seq. 的实体瘤和正常的垂体组织的比较分析.
- 对A/B区块,拓相关域 (TADs) 和染色质环的表征.
- 整合结构性基因组数据与基因表达特征.
主要成果:
- 索马托瘤的染色体相互作用频率和TAD大小降低,TAD和循环数量增加.
- 三维染色体结构的改变与基因表达的变化相关,特别是在A区.
- 与增强的绝缘和增加的循环相关的TCF7L2的升级促进了瘤细胞的增殖和生长激素的分泌.

Chromatin is the massive complex of DNA and proteins packaged inside the nucleus. The complexity of chromatin folding and how it is packaged inside the nucleus greatly influences access to genetic information. Generally, the nucleus' periphery is considered transcriptionally repressive, while the cell's interior is considered a transcriptionally active area.
